Scott Taylor
Washington D.C. artist (b.196? - present)
Washington DC based singer Scott Taylor recorded his first dance single in 1985, a tune entittled "SWEAT THE NIGHT AWAY", on Harms Way Records.
Later, after auditioning over the telephone, he landed a recording sitiuation with George Mitchell of Back Beat Records. The first release "It's Not That Far Away", a garage house tune,(produced by Mitchell) did well on the underground scene and reached #1 on many playlists in U.S. and UK in 1991.
The second release,"Don't Turn Your Back" was one of the first records re-mixed by DEEP DISH. It became another underground success in the US and abroad.
